Acoustic doors in high use environments demand careful planning that blends architectural intent with practical performance. Start by identifying the primary sound goals: speech privacy, bass control, or overall ambience containment. Consider door mass, sealing, and frame construction as the core levers for isolation. In busy homes such as media rooms or home theaters, frequent door use means hardware should resist wear while remaining quiet. Materials vary from solid-core wood to composite panels, each with different weight, density, and resilience. A well-chosen door system aligns with the wall assembly and existing acoustical treatments to minimize flanking noise and avoid pressure imbalances when doors swing closed or are propped open.
When assessing door types, prioritize assemblies that combine a dense core, airtight seals, and robust hinges. A double-action or pivot design may suit recreational spaces, provided it includes weatherstripping and compression gaskets that interact well with the frame. The door leaf should tuck neatly into a prefinished jamb with a continuous seal around the perimeter. Pay attention to head and jamb alignment, as gaps along the top or sides dramatically influence performance. In addition, select hardware that tolerates frequent use without loosening or squeaking. A high-quality latch with a soft-closing mechanism helps preserve the acoustic integrity even when the door is operated quickly by curious family members.
Installation accuracy and ongoing maintenance sustain acoustic reliability over time.
The procurement phase should include field measurements and a knock-testing approach to validate fit and acoustic performance. Measure rough openings with precision, accounting for plaster, trim, and flooring transitions that impact clearances. Request laboratory or field test data showing Sound Transmission Class (STC) and Impact Isolation Class (IIC) ratings under conditions similar to your room use. Look for doors that demonstrate consistent performance across temperature and humidity swings, since these factors can shift tolerances in wood and composite materials. As you compare products, consider the frame’s stiffness and the door’s butt joints, which influence long-term stabilization. A well-verified specification reduces post-installation surprises and costly remakes.

Installation logistics play a decisive role in achieving promised acoustics. A precise installation preserves the door’s sealed interfaces and prevents warping that could compromise performance. Ensure the frame is anchored to solid framing members and not just drywall, which weakens seals. Use gasket systems that compress evenly without distortion as the door operates. Calibrate hinges to maintain a consistent gap that allows smooth closure and consistent sealing. Identify any potential interference from electrical conduits, HVAC diffusers, or floor transitions that might create microchannels. After hanging, adjust weatherstripping for a firm yet gentle contact along the entire perimeter, testing door closure from multiple angles and at varied speeds.
A layered approach enhances isolation while preserving comfort and convenience.
In busy rooms, the door’s operation should be as quiet as the seal itself. Choose hardware that minimizes squeaks, rattle, and handle noise, especially in family spaces with children. Soft-close hinges, dampers, and anti-rattle plates reduce audible disturbances when doors are used during movie nights or late arrivals. Maintenance planning is essential; lubricate hinges and track components per manufacturer instructions and check seals annually for compression loss or damage. If doors see heavy traffic, inspect the threshold and weatherstripping for embedded debris that can degrade sealing effectiveness. A routine adjustment schedule helps preserve acoustic performance without requiring frequent major interventions.

Diversify your approach by leveraging complementary sound-control strategies alongside doors. Treat the adjacent walls with absorptive panels, bass traps, or decoupled surfaces to minimize side-channel leakage. Consider under-door sweeps or door-bottom seals to close the small gaps at floor level that standard seals often overlook. Implement door sweeps designed for high-use environments to resist wear while maintaining effective contact. Ensure interior finishes around the doorway minimize reflective surfaces that could amplify unwanted echoes. In some layouts, a dual-door system with an inner acoustic door can provide flexible control between a busy corridor and a quiet listening space, when access must remain constant yet contained.

Testing should extend beyond initial installation to confirm sustained performance. Use quick, repeatable measurements with a basic sound level meter to compare room-to-room noise floors before and after modifications. Document any changes in ambient noise when doors are in motion and during simulated high-traffic periods. Gather feedback from frequent room users about perceived privacy, door feel, and closure reliability. If discrepancies emerge, revisit the sealing strategy, adjust the threshold, and reseal problematic joints. A thorough testing cycle provides actionable data, guiding future upgrades without unnecessary expenditures. It also helps validate whether the investment meets your daily living expectations as it ages.
Budget considerations influence door selection as strongly as acoustical targets do. Higher mass cores and multi-point seals increase costs but deliver superior isolation. Weigh the cost against anticipated usage, room function, and future remodel plans. If the theater area doubles as a media hub, durability should outrank cosmetic refinements. Choose finishes and materials that resist scuffs and humidity while maintaining a refined appearance. Factor in delivery times, lead times for custom cores, and potential delays due to specialty hardware. A well-planned budget encourages choosing a system that remains practical for years, rather than chasing marginal gains that rapidly erode value.

Integrating safety, accessibility, and long-term value for listeners.
Some rooms benefit from a modular approach that allows easy upgrades. Start with a solid core door and robust seals, then layer in optional enhancements like mass-loaded vinyl wraps or independent glazing to tailor the acoustic profile. If you expect frequent projectors or screen installations, ensure interfaces accommodate mounting hardware without compromising seals. Consider interior design implications, such as door color, finish, and trim compatibility with media equipment furniture. A modular design reduces downtime during future renovations and lets you upgrade acoustics incrementally as technology evolves, keeping the system relevant without complete rework.
Finally, plan for accessibility and safety in high-use doors. In home theaters and media rooms, you may need to balance sound isolation with compliant clearances for mobility aids and emergency egress. Check that hardware and thresholds meet relevant codes without blocking passage widths. Ensure automatic doors or proximity-activated entries have reliable safety features, including pinch protection and clear signage. When families with children use the space, consider soft-closing mechanisms that minimize pinched fingers while maintaining the door’s acoustic performance. A thoughtful integration of safety, convenience, and acoustic intent yields a door system that serves every member of the household.
Long-term care strategies help preserve door performance across seasons and years. Create a maintenance calendar that includes seal inspections, hinge lubrication, and alignment checks every six to twelve months, depending on usage. Record any perceptible shifts in sound isolation and closure behavior to catch problems early. If signs of wear appear on the frame or leaf, assess whether a minor repair or a full retrofit is warranted. Remain prepared to adjust the threshold or seals to maintain airtight contacts as room finishes settle. A proactive routine protects your acoustic goals and keeps operations smooth for busy households.
